淘寶接口開發(fā)實(shí)現(xiàn)如何劃分環(huán)節(jié)
有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個(gè)工作日內(nèi)與您取得聯(lián)系。
淘寶接口開發(fā)實(shí)現(xiàn)如何劃分環(huán)節(jié)
隨著互聯(lián)網(wǎng)技術(shù)的快速發(fā)展,越來越多的企業(yè)選擇通過第三方接口來實(shí)現(xiàn)自己產(chǎn)品的功能擴(kuò)展。淘寶作為國內(nèi)最大的電商平臺之一,提供了豐富的接口供開發(fā)者使用。本文將詳細(xì)介紹如何劃分淘寶接口開發(fā)的環(huán)節(jié),以及每個(gè)環(huán)節(jié)的具體實(shí)現(xiàn)方法。
一、確定開發(fā)目標(biāo)
在進(jìn)行淘寶接口開發(fā)之前,首先要明確自己的開發(fā)目標(biāo)。具體來說,需要考慮以下幾個(gè)方面:
1. 確定要實(shí)現(xiàn)的接口功能:例如訂單查詢、商品搜索、用戶信息獲取等。
2. 確定目標(biāo)平臺:如Web、Android、iOS等。
3. 確定開發(fā)語言:如Java、Python、Objective-C等。
二、申請開發(fā)者賬號與接口權(quán)限
1. 注冊成為淘寶開放平臺開發(fā)者:訪問淘寶開放平臺官網(wǎng)(https://open.taobao.com/),注冊并登錄。
2. 創(chuàng)建應(yīng)用:在“我的應(yīng)用”頁面,點(diǎn)擊“創(chuàng)建應(yīng)用”,填寫應(yīng)用信息,包括應(yīng)用名稱、應(yīng)用類型、應(yīng)用圖標(biāo)等。
3. 申請接口權(quán)限:在“我的應(yīng)用”頁面,點(diǎn)擊“權(quán)限管理”,申請所需接口的權(quán)限。
三、熟悉接口文檔
淘寶開放平臺提供了詳細(xì)的接口文檔,開發(fā)者需要對其進(jìn)行熟悉。具體包括以下幾個(gè)方面:
1. 接口概述:了解接口的功能、用途、請求方法等。
2. 請求參數(shù):了解接口所需的請求參數(shù)及其格式、類型、必填項(xiàng)等。
3. 響應(yīng)參數(shù):了解接口返回的響應(yīng)參數(shù)及其格式、類型、必填項(xiàng)等。
4. 接口示例:通過接口示例了解請求與響應(yīng)的數(shù)據(jù)格式。
四、接口開發(fā)
1. 請求接口:根據(jù)接口文檔,使用指定的請求方法(如GET、POST等)向接口地址發(fā)送請求。請求時(shí)需攜帶應(yīng)用授權(quán)信息(如App Key、App Secret等),以獲取接口返回的數(shù)據(jù)。
2. 解析響應(yīng):將接口返回的數(shù)據(jù)進(jìn)行解析,提取所需的信息。如遇錯(cuò)誤,需要對錯(cuò)誤信息進(jìn)行處理。
3. 異常處理:在接口開發(fā)過程中,需要考慮到網(wǎng)絡(luò)異常、服務(wù)器異常等情況,對異常進(jìn)行合理的處理。
五、接口集成
1. 獲取授權(quán)信息:在開發(fā)過程中,需要獲取到應(yīng)用的授權(quán)信息,如App Key、App Secret等。
2. 配置接口:將開發(fā)好的接口與目標(biāo)平臺進(jìn)行集成,如在Web頁面中引入JavaScript文件,或在Android應(yīng)用中引入Java類等。
3. 測試:在集成完成后,需要對接口進(jìn)行測試,確保其功能正常。
六、接口優(yōu)化與維護(hù)
1. 性能優(yōu)化:針對接口的性能進(jìn)行優(yōu)化,如減少請求次數(shù)、降低服務(wù)器負(fù)載等。
2. 接口升級:根據(jù)淘寶開放平臺的更新,及時(shí)升級接口,以獲取新功能、修復(fù)Bug等。
3. 異常監(jiān)控:對接口進(jìn)行異常監(jiān)控,發(fā)現(xiàn)異常及時(shí)進(jìn)行處理。
總結(jié)
淘寶接口開發(fā)實(shí)現(xiàn)需要經(jīng)過明確開發(fā)目標(biāo)、申請開發(fā)者賬號與接口權(quán)限、熟悉接口文檔、接口開發(fā)、接口集成、接口優(yōu)化與維護(hù)等環(huán)節(jié)。在開發(fā)過程中,要注重代碼質(zhì)量、性能優(yōu)化、異常處理等方面,確保接口能夠穩(wěn)定、高效地運(yùn)行。
有開發(fā)需求的客戶可以在文章上方留言給我們,我們會在兩個(gè)工作日內(nèi)與您取得聯(lián)系。